SIN (version 0.5)

A SINful Approach to Selection of Gaussian Graphical Markov Models

Description

This package provides routines to perform SIN model selection as described in Drton & Perlman (2004, 2008). The selected models are represented in the format of the 'ggm' package, which allows in particular parameter estimation in the selected model.
